The Village of Rose View is a senior living community for people aged 55 and older, set up in a townhouse layout in the West Grove area, so you'll find one-floor living with easy access throughout the home, and it's really got a comfortable style with things like 9-foot and cathedral ceilings, real hardwood floors, and a mix of finishes with drywall, tile, and carpet in the living spaces. Homes in this community usually have two bedrooms and two full bathrooms, and they're known for larger rooms and a primary suite that fits a king-size bed, has his and her walk-in closets, and an ensuite bath with a granite double vanity, stall shower, soaking tub, and two walk-in closets, so it's got plenty of space for storage and comfort. There's also a hall bath with a tub and shower for guests or a second occupant. The kitchen tends to be open and bright, with granite counters, a center island with a raised breakfast bar, 42-inch cherry cabinets, stainless steel appliances-including an ENERGY STAR fridge and electric range-plus a large walk-in pantry and a breakfast nook. Next to the kitchen, a spacious great room and a morning room bring in lots of sunlight, and you might have a fireplace with glass doors for chilly days. Each home also comes with a ground floor laundry room, a full unfinished basement with egress for storage or finishing, and a big attached two-car garage with inside entry, an opener, and more parking in the driveway.
Outside, most homes have a patio you can get to from the living room for fresh air, and the landscaping adds curb appeal with sidewalks, street lights, and yard space. Community grounds are well-kept, with maintenance, snow removal, trash, and lawn care managed by the HOA, so residents have less to worry about. People like meeting up at the private clubhouse, which serves as a spot for relaxation and group activities, offering a meeting room, card room, billiard room, library, fitness center, and sometimes a wellness or spa area. Walking trails loop through the neighborhood, and there are places for outdoor programs or just a stroll on a nice day. For those who need them, community services can include housekeeping, laundry, and help with daily tasks, as well as a 24-hour call system for safety, so there's a focus on feeling secure and supported in daily life.
Homes here have central air conditioning, natural gas heating, public water and sewer, and a concrete foundation with vinyl or aluminum siding and a shingle roof, so the construction is modern and easy to maintain. Living spaces measure around 1,700 to 1,800 square feet, leaving room for both privacy and gathering, and lots of upgrades show care by previous owners.
